Output 721f138ab4c47fadf3bedb5f8d90c95581714b0f5e7b50e6e791d1773379af98:0

value
840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d2543e335d2748e21a8dd17d49ffa7cb260dbaa OP_EQUAL
address
3MrKuAjzzhLa95P1DtWyxLAGpBwL9TK2hc
transaction
721f138ab4c47fadf3bedb5f8d90c95581714b0f5e7b50e6e791d1773379af98
confirmations
134158
spent
true